I am trying to get the Tuya integration working. I am able to log in on my IOS phone into the Tuya app. I have made sure it is indeed the actual Tuya app, not a reskinned or 3rd party app. I can also log in using the account on the IOT website from Tuya.

When I follow the process for the integration to 'log in' to the Tuya account I use the user code found in the Tuya app, I get a QR code, but when I scan it and press the 'Confirm login' button I get the message 'Please use the designated APP to scan the code to log in'. If I click 'submit' on HA I get a message 'Login Error' (which makes sense since it apparently hasn't linked to the account yet).

Using Home Assistant OS on a Raspi 5, Core 2026.2.3, Supervisor 2026.02.3, OS 17.1, Frontend 20260128.6. If I scan the QR outside of the app, I get the following syntax: 'tuyaSmart--qrLogin?token=EU<hash>'.

OOoooh... They have indeed. For others running into this: Upgrading to HA Core 2026.3.0 fixed the above problem (for me and apparently @silk frigate ) 😉
